It's time to vote for the pub you think should win the ultimate title of CityLife Pub Of The Year 2010.

Our local winners for each area - covered by the Manchester Evening News and our 16 local weekly papers - are being pitted against each other in a text vote, in a bid to find the most popular overall venue. 

Between March 1 and April 11, thousands of you voted for your favourite pub. Then, between April 12 and 18, our team of mystery drinkers visited the top-voted three venues from each area to select the best from each. These winners are listed below.

To vote for your favourite, text one of the options shown below to 82540.

Voting will be open between Monday, April 26 and Sunday, May 9.

The champion will be announced during the week commencing May 10.
